User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.0; en-US; rv:1.5b) Gecko/20030812 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.0; en-US; rv:1.5b) Gecko/20030812 Nearly every site has cookies. Most sites have no cookie policy. Thus, popping up a cookie notification on every site is not yet of much value. If you are going to flag a cookie and present a cookie notification on the bottom, when one clicks on the cookie notification one should find out which cookies a particular web page has associated with it.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Go to any web page that has cookies (like www.cnn.com or some such) 2. Click on cookie notification 3. Try to pick out the cookies from the cookie manager. Actual Results: I got frustrated. Expected Results: Specify which cookies are associated with a web page.
